Subject: [PATCH 4/4] spi: airoha: avoid usage of flash specific parameters
|
|
|
|
The spinand driver do 3 type of dirmap requests:
|
|
* read/write whole flash page without oob
|
|
(offs = 0, len = page_size)
|
|
* read/write whole flash page including oob
|
|
(offs = 0, len = page_size + oob_size)
|
|
* read/write oob area only
|
|
(offs = page_size, len = oob_size)
|
|
|
|
The trick is:
|
|
* read/write a single "sector"
|
|
* set a custom sector size equal to offs + len. It's a bit safer to
|
|
round up "sector size" value 64.
|
|
* set the transfer length equal to custom sector size
|
|
|
|
And it works!
|
|
|
|
Thus we can find all data directly from dirmap request, so flash specific
|
|
parameters is not needed anymore. Also
|
|
* airoha_snand_nfi_config(),
|
|
* airoha_snand_nfi_setup()
|
|
functions becomes unnecessary.
